Definition of Swerve
Swerve

To stray; to wander; to rope.

To go out of a straight line; to deflect.

To wander from any line prescribed, or from a rule or duty; to depart from what is established by law, duty, custom, or the like; to deviate.

To bend; to incline.

To climb or move upward by winding or turning.

To turn aside.
